Kia Continues With Strong Sales Numbers

    IRVINE, Calif., March 1 Kia announced today vehicle sales
of 12,665 for the month of February, an increase of 10 percent over February
2000.

    The Rio subcompact sedan led the way with 3,784 units sold, followed by
Sephia sales of 3,513.  The Optima midsize sedan continued its early success,
posting sales of 1,256 units in only its second full month on the market.  The
strong showing in February, following a successful January, has Kia's year-to-
date sales -- 25,178 units -- up 22% from 2000.

    Kia Motors America is the U.S. sales, marketing and service arm of Kia
Motors Corp. in Seoul, South Korea.

                             MONTH OF FEBRUARY          YEAR-TO-DATE
    Model                     2001        2000        2001        2000
    Optima                   1,256         n/a       2,913         n/a
    Rio                      3,784         n/a       7,072         n/a
    Sephia                   3,513       6,421       6,697      11,394
    Spectra                  1,367         n/a       3,099         n/a
    Sportage                 2,580       4,665       5,065       7,621
    Sportage 2-Door
     Convertible               165         306         332         520

    Total                   12,665      11,392      25,178      19,535
